1. CPU: The Brain of Your Machine 🧠

Think of the Central Processing Unit (CPU) as the brain of your computer. It handles all the general-purpose tasks, from running your operating system to opening apps and browsing the web. CPUs are designed to handle a wide range of tasks efficiently, making them the Swiss Army knife of computing. 🛠️
But here’s the kicker: CPUs are built for speed and versatility. They have fewer cores (usually 2 to 32) compared to GPUs, but each core can handle complex instructions and multitask like a pro. If you’re into gaming, video editing, or any task that requires quick decision-making, a powerful CPU is your best friend. 🎮🎥

2. GPU: The Powerhouse of Visuals 🎨

Now, let’s talk about the Graphics Processing Unit (GPU). This bad boy is all about rendering visuals and handling parallel processing tasks. While CPUs are great for general tasks, GPUs excel at handling large amounts of data simultaneously. Think of it as having a team of workers instead of a single super-smart individual. 🏃‍♂️🏃‍♀️
GPUs are packed with hundreds or even thousands of cores, making them perfect for tasks like 3D rendering, video encoding, and, of course, gaming. 3. When to Choose a CPU Over a GPU 🤔

So, when should you prioritize a CPU over a GPU? Here are a few scenarios:
- **General Computing:** If you’re a casual user who mostly browses the web, uses office applications, and streams videos, a mid-range CPU will do the job just fine. 📱💻
- **Programming and Development:** Developers often need a CPU that can handle multiple threads and complex algorithms. A powerful CPU ensures smooth coding and debugging. 💻👩‍💻
- **Multitasking:** If you run multiple applications simultaneously, a CPU with more cores and higher clock speeds will keep everything running smoothly. 🚀📊

4. When to Choose a GPU Over a CPU 🤩

On the flip side, when should you go all-in on a GPU?
- **Gaming:** For hardcore gamers, a high-end GPU is non-negotiable. It ensures smooth frame rates and stunning visuals in the latest games. 🎮💥
- **Content Creation:** Video editors, 3D artists, and graphic designers benefit immensely from powerful GPUs. They can render videos faster, create complex 3D models, and handle large datasets with ease. 🎥🎨
- **Machine Learning and AI:** GPUs are the go-to choice for training machine learning models and performing complex AI computations. Their parallel processing capabilities make them ideal for these tasks. 🤖💡
